API Google Calendar REST не возвращает заголовок и другие поля событий - PullRequest
1 голос
/ 01 ноября 2019

Метод Google REST API GET (https://developers.google.com/calendar/v3/reference/events/get) должен возвращать эту структуру (https://developers.google.com/calendar/v3/reference/events#resource),, если я что-то упустил.

Мне нужно получить заголовок и описание события для использованияв моем приложении. Вместо этого я получаю ответ ниже.

Я пытался изменить видимость события (общедоступное / частное) и доступность (свободная / занятая). На самом деле API не показывает события с бесплатной доступностью,для которого у меня тоже нет решения.

Вот скриншот экрана редактирования события: https://www.screencast.com/t/X8bRS8kJDT

{
   "kind":"calendar#event",
   "etag":"\"3145149995624000\"",
   "id":"5fnlvcl2msab46p8roqbahhb6g",
   "status":"confirmed",
   "htmlLink":"https://www.google.com/calendar/event?eid=NWZubHZjbDJtc2FiNDZwOHJvcWJhaGhiNmcgZWQtYWRtaW4uY29tXzMwOHNycjdzdjdiM28xazRpdjZ2cm9mb3Y0QGc",
   "updated":"2019-11-01T02:23:17.812Z",
   "start":{
      "dateTime":"2019-11-11T09:30:00+11:00"
   },
   "end":{
      "dateTime":"2019-11-11T10:00:00+11:00"
   },
   "visibility":"private",
   "iCalUID":"5fnlvcl2msab46p8roqbahhb6g@google.com"
}

Существуют ли другие способы получения подробностей событий календаря с REST API, в том числес бесплатной доступностью?

Спасибо.

1 Ответ

0 голосов
/ 06 ноября 2019

Вы можете попробовать указать поля, которые вы хотите получить, как на картинке ниже:

enter image description here

Или вы можете поставить "*" как изображение ниже для получения всех значений:

enter image description here

поля - это стандартный запроспараметр, который указывает, какие значения вы хотите включить в свой ответ. Чтобы узнать больше об этом, вы можете проверить Здесь .

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...